Also, making sure that children’s beds bunk are properly assembled and maintained will further reduce the chance of accidents.The most common reason for injuries that occur in kids beds bunk is falling off the top bed. It is crucial to install guardrails along the sides of the bed’s top to stop this. These rails must rise at 5 inches or more above the surface of the mattress to prevent accidental falls.It is important to make sure that the railings are not loose or gapped, and the space between them is narrow enough to prevent the head or limbs of a child from being caught. It is an ideal idea for the mattress to fit within the frame of the bunk beds to avoid gaps that could cause danger.It is also recommended that parents supervise children who sleep on the top bunk, and teach them how to climb the ladder. It is also a great idea to remove any tripping hazard or obstructions between the top bunk and ladder access point.Generally speaking, it’s recommended to only allow one child to sleep on the top bunk, since children younger than 6 are not capable of safely navigating the ladder. It is also a good idea to check your bunk bed frequently to find any broken or loose parts, or any damage that needs to be tightened. Also, be sure to follow the weight limits set by the manufacturer on the upper and lower bunks. The stability of the bed can be enhanced by ensuring that the ladder is secured to the bunk and at a height that is safe for children to climb.Another aspect to consider is the guardrails that are installed on both sides of the top bunk to minimise the risk of falling. They should be set at 5 inches or more above the mattress’s surface and checked regularly for damage or poor installation. A quality mattress should also be chosen to fit within the frame, preventing gaps that could lead to entrapment hazards. In addition, it’s recommended to take into consideration the capacity of the mattress, anticipating potential growth and change in body weight over time.If you have a steel bunk bed, it’s also a good idea to check for loose or missing fasteners on a regular basis.
